Step 2: Identify Major Challenges in Development

  • Analyze the following key challenges faced by Indonesia:
    • Economic disparities among regions.
    • Environmental issues related to deforestation and pollution.
    • Education quality and accessibility.
    • Health care systems and public health concerns.
  • Discuss how these challenges impact overall national progress.
